Keep Keeping the floss taut when you pull the needle as a result of. You can vary the dimensions within your French knots by wrapping the floss around the needle wherever between a single and thrice.

Preferred in goldwork, couching is a technique utilised to attach thread to the area of The material. It is very helpful if a thread is simply too thick or fragile for the fabric you are stitching on. Couching can be an historic approach that's been found in artifacts from historic Egypt and nomadic tribes from the primary millenium.
